(Reuters) - Steve Smith's unorthodox batting technique is not something a purist will advocate to budding players, but his monstrous run-scoring ability might force coaching manuals to be rewritten, former Australia cricketer Adam Gilchrist has said.
Twitchy at the crease, Smith extravagantly shuffles across his stumps with his bat's backlift pointing towards gully - all a strict no when youngsters are learning the art of batting.
